Darius’s Story

Finding What Works for You

"Keep your daily concurrency of dogs at a limit you’re comfortable with! Find a style of grooming that works for you around safety and keep practicing/watching others senior groomers around you! Do not get discouraged."

I've been grooming for 5 years 6 months! To be completely frank, I felt the moment in my career that made me feel like I’m doing something great has to be the moment when Andis reached out to me. It was a sense of accomplishment and it made me even more motivated to strive to be a more successful dog groomer. One of the biggest disappointments in my career has to be leaving the establishment that actually taught me the craft of grooming.
